Clifton Davis has sent The Jackson 5 fans into full nostalgia mode with a heartfelt performance on 'Beyond the Gates'. For the unversed, the soap opera is celebrating the holiday season with special episodes airing from Monday, December 22, to Friday, December 26. In one standout moment, Davis surprised viewers with an emotional rendition of the Jackson 5 classic 'Never Can Say Goodbye,' moving fans with the throwback performance.

Davis performed 'Never Can Say Goodbye', the 1971 hit he wrote for The Jackson 5, in a special holiday episode of 'Beyond the Gates' airing on Christmas Eve. In the episode, Davis' character, Vernon Dupree, sings the song to his wife, Anita, played by Tamara Tunie, in a moment previewed exclusively by Billboard. Davis talked about the full-circle moment of performing 'Never Can Say Goodbye'. "It's quite amazing to think I wrote this song way, way back, and now it's been written into the show's story plot," he told Billboard.

 

He further added, "It's exciting to be singing and sharing this song with another generation… It's a song that just keeps on giving. I'm humbled as well because it didn't have to turn out this way. God is good." Released 54 years ago, the Hal Davis–produced The Jackson 5 hit reached No. 2 on the Billboard Hot 100 and topped the Hot R&B/Hip-Hop Songs chart.

The song also earned Davis a Grammy nomination, with later covers by artists like Isaac Hayes and Gloria Gaynor. The song's legacy mirrors Davis' own enduring career, which spans Broadway ('Wicked,' 'Two Gentlemen of Verona'), television ('Amen,' 'Madam Secretary'), and film ('Any Given Sunday'). Talking about 'Beyond the Gates', CBS has released the first promo for season 2 of the show, set to premiere in 2026, teasing major romance and drama.

The teaser opens at a glamorous Dupree household party, where matriarch Anita Dupree (Tamara Tunie) promises, "This party is going to be brimming with surprises." Quick cuts highlight steamy moments between Kat (Colby Muhammad) and Thomas (Alex Alegria), Vanessa (Lauren Buglioli) and Joey (Jon Lindstrom), and a playful joke from Martin (Brandon Claybon) to his husband, Smitty (Mike Manning), as he says, "Hopefully, it's involving fewer clothes."

Romantic tension also builds as Leslie (Trisha Mann Grant) flirts with Marcell (Darryl W Handy), saying, "Oh, baby, I'm counting on it." At the same time, Nicole (Daphnée Duplaix) shares a charged moment with Dr. Carlton (Robert Christopher Riley), promising a wilder season of love and intrigue, as per Parade. The promo also teases steamy moments among the Dupree family. Dani Dupree Richardson (Karla Mosley) flirts with her husband, Andre (Sean Freeman), saying, "I married a genie, the sexy one who grants all my wishes."
